Customers are saying

Customers admire the MB-D16 Multi Power Battery Pack for its extended battery life, which is great for extended photography sessions. They also appreciate the improved grip and rotation abilities it provides, making it more comfortable to handle the camera, especially in portrait mode. While some find the battery pack to be a bit heavy and expensive, many agree that the build quality and design are excellent.

    Battery pack provides extra power and switches over to the main camera battery when low. Powered by AA batteries. Love the additional grip when using in portrait mode.

    This battery pack came with my camera package which was great! I had priced it before I purchased and didn't realize it was part of the package. Interesting set up as you have the battery pack with one battery in it and the camera holding the other battery. The pack attaches to the camera without having to remove the other one, different from my D90 but way more convenient! Oh, and I saved 350.00!

    Once you realize how valuable a vertical grip/shutter release is, you have to have it. On the D750 with its articulating view screen, the vertical grip and the extra shutter release offer the shooter a lot more flexibility, especially when composing images without looking through the viewfinder. The extra battery life is helpful, but I value the viewfinder the most for how easily and naturally it works.
